民工哥剛開始接觸系統運維之時,基本上都是純人肉運維時代,99%的工作都是手工進行的,因爲,那個時候,一個企業的服務器架構、數據量、業務量等指標沒有現在這麼龐大。
隨着互聯網不斷髮展、迭代更新,公司業務的增長,上述的一些指標也會隨之增大,這個時候,單純的人工運維無法滿足日常的需求,而且還會導致大量重複的工作,所以,這個時候,腳本自動化替代一些手工重複的運維工作職責是必要的。
所以,運維工程師們對於Shell腳本的技能掌握也越來越重要,而且,在減少重複工作量的同時,也會提高不少工作效率!因此,Shell腳本編程也是運維工程師必備的工作技能之一!
之前也寫過一些相關的文章:shell腳本編程基礎介紹,這是介紹一些基礎的文章,適合入門的初學者;如果你有一定基礎,想自己動手寫一寫,推薦你看看:Shell腳本編寫思路與過程 和 高效編寫shell腳本的10個建議;需要練練手也可以看看這篇文章:10 個實戰及面試常用 Shell 腳本編寫。
還給大家整理了一些常用的面試題和Shell編程的一些高級用法:
語言就是需要先理論,後實戰,再總結,如此循環之後,相信你的各方面能力都會有很大的提高。
有不少讀者後臺,經常問我有沒有相關的實戰案例分享分享,所以,民工哥利用空餘時間收集整理了一些工作中常用的案例分享給大家,話不多說,直接上圖:
估計約了100+個案例分享,目前整理出來40+,後續會繼續更新分享出來給大家,也算是民工哥公衆號讀者的一種福利吧。
如何獲得呢?直接在公衆號後臺回覆關鍵詞:shell腳本實戰100例
收集、排版、整理不易,花了不少的時間去整理、排版。還請各位讀者點個在看與轉發分享支持一波!你的支持是民工哥持續創作的動力!!!